These … Web8 mrt. 2014 · Well, xcorr2 can essentially be seen as analyzing all possible shifts in both positive and negative direction and giving a measure for how well they fit with each shift. Therefore for images of size N x N the result must have size (2*N-1) x (2*N-1), where the correlation at index [N, N] would be maximal if the two images where equal or not shifted.
